The optimal installation conditions for Viessmann Vitosol 200-T SP2A solar panels include a south-facing orientation with an inclination angle between 30 and 45 degrees. They should be installed in an area with minimal shading throughout the day to maximize solar exposure.
Start by checking the solar controller settings and ensure the pump is functioning. Inspect the collector for any physical damage or obstructions. Additionally, make sure the heat transfer fluid levels are sufficient and the system is properly pressurized.
Regular maintenance includes cleaning the glass surface to remove dirt and debris, checking for leaks in the hydraulic connections, and inspecting the mounting hardware. Additionally, the heat transfer fluid should be checked annually and replaced every 5 years.

Always turn off the solar pump and allow the system to cool before performing maintenance. Wear appropriate PPE when handling heat transfer fluids. Ensure all electrical components are isolated before inspection.
To maximize performance, ensure the panels are cleaned regularly and free from obstructions. Optimize the tilt angle seasonally if possible and ensure the solar controller is correctly configured. Regular maintenance checks are essential to keep the system operating efficiently.
The Viessmann Vitosol 200-T SP2A solar panels are designed to last over 20 years with proper maintenance, although individual components like the heat transfer fluid may need more frequent replacement.
